 Corruption list:
Balrog Aura:
  Surrounds you with a fiery aura
  But it can burn scrolls when you read them

Balrog Wings:
  Creates ugly, but working, wings allowing you to fly
  But it reduces charisma by 4 and dexterity by 2

Balrog Strength:
  Provides 3 strength and 1 constitution
  But it reduces charisma by 1 and dexterity by 3

Balrog Form:
  Allows you to turn into a Balrog at will
  You need Balrog Wings, Balrog Aura and Balrog Strength to activate it

Demon Spirit:
  Increases your intelligence by 1
  But reduce your charisma by 2

Demon Hide:
  Increases your armour class by your level
  Provides immunity to fire at level 40
  But reduces speed by your level / 7

Demon Breath:
  Provides fire breath
  But gives a small chance to spoil potions when you quaff them

Demon Realm:
  Provides access to the demon school skill and the use of demonic equipment
  You need Demon Spirit, Demon Hide and Demon Breath to activate it

Random teleportation:
  Randomly teleports you around

Troll Blood:
  Troll blood flows in your veins, granting increased regeneration
  It also enables you to feel the presence of other troll beings
  But it will make your presence more noticeable and aggravating

On 29.7.2005 02:09 veryfoobar-tome@yahoo.com wrote:
Thought I'd try a Maia swordmaster using demonology through corruptions.
Maia stat boosts should help with negative effects of corruptions, and I have aggravate already. Got random teleport as my first corruption, but it only bothers me when digging.
The luck bonus on Maias should help if I find the Gothmog set.
Found a corruption potion in the Downs and Caves, and now I'm sitting on a fountain of it in Mirkwood.
Wouldn't you know, I got Demon Realm without Troll Blood yet. Of course, I'll keep drinking for the regen.
Would have been nice to skip the teleport corruptions instead.
I'm so going to wear the one ring if I get that far.

On 1.8.2005 18:15 veryfoobar-tome@yahoo.com wrote:
Scummed Mirkwood 10-15-20 for the Gothmog set, now it's on to Mordor. Durandil got blasted while scumming, but don't need it any more. A few scrolls of craftsmanship would be nice :-).

On 1.8.2005 19:49 dzhang@its.caltech.edu wrote:
Lol, a few, as in 20? To get Gothmog up to a positive pval..

On 5.8.2005 08:01 veryfoobar-tome@yahoo.com wrote:
Well, that wasn't so bad a at all. Wall creation in Thaum group b (Thaum from FF) really helped. Thaum is so nice as a utility skill, what with cheap walls & poly chaos bolts for nasties, force to knock things back, etc.
The only really dicey moments came with a 12-greater-balrog princess quest, and Morgoth's earthquakes messing up my anti-summoning walls. 98 princesses was overkill, this guy did not need the points from FF, probably because Demonology from the corruption is so cheap.
Sure was nice not to bother with that silly Mt Doom quest!
Grow mold on this guy is really pretty useless. I really wanted it on my Ent, that would have been so much more appropriate I think.
